New Delhi: Polling is going on in four states of West Bengal, Tamil Nadu, Assam, Kerala and Union Territory of Puducherry on Tuesday. In Assam, Puducherry, Kerala and Tamil Nadu, where the counting of votes will be held on May 2, after the completion of the voting today, in West Bengal, even after the third round of voting, 5 phase elections will remain.

Updates from 5 States:


Actor Rajinikanth voted in Tamil Nadu.

TMC has accused the CRPF of not allowing voters to enter the booths without voter slips at booth no-54, 54A in the Diamond Harbor Assembly in District-South 24 Parganas in Bengal.

Senior Congress leader P Chidambaram voted at the polling station. During this, he said that "our secular progressive alliance is ready for a resounding victory because the people of Tamil Nadu want a change."

The Chief Electoral Officer of Tamil Nadu said that till 9 am in the state, 13.80% polling was done.

In Bengal, till 9 o'clock, 14.62 percent polling was done. In this, 15.52 percent polling was recorded in Howrah, 17.35 percent in Hooghly and 12.81 percent in South 24 Parganas district.

Kerala Health Minister KK Selja cast his vote in Kannur. During this, he said that COVID19 has a mortality rate of 0.4% in Kerala today. We did many social welfare works during COVID19. People are watching all this and they will vote for us.
